Output ebfa012c2a19a71cb94b594e53da6c41b6b265377599d8a839d7f46d08861cbe:1

value
66698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d4530aa2605c37ee34ad6ed4a0fa841e4b6582 OP_EQUAL
address
39szRB1BRBt3GmgKD3mPjSBcNvUwugP889
transaction
ebfa012c2a19a71cb94b594e53da6c41b6b265377599d8a839d7f46d08861cbe
spent
true